The Snowy Dessert Ginger Cookie Blusher is a two-toned blusher with a bronze color. It has a sweet ginger bread man imprinted and I really hesitated to use my brush on this blusher, because I feared the cute ginger bread man would disappear. So far I’ve used this blush quite often but you still see the ginger bread man luckily!

Etude House Pink Bird

The color of this blusher is very light and swatched on my hand you hardly see anything apart from a glowy, bronze shimmer. Nevertheless, when I applied it on my cheeks the color is more vibrant and visible, resulting in a brownish/ bronze color which is more than lovely for fall and winter season. The Snowy Desser Ginger Cookie Blusher contains 9 g of product and retails for 16.80 US$. It doesn’t come with a puff or a brush. The Etude House Snowy Desser Pudding Tint in Shade 3 called Grapefruit Pudding comes in a cardboard box designed like those cake boxes you will receive at some bakeries. Another super adorable designed product! Once you open the cardboard box you will find the tint in a small jar together with a spoon/spatula.

Etude House Pink Bird

The Snowy Dessert Pudding Tint has a pudding texture, as the name suggests, which also remind me a bit of some mousse or other desserts like that. Kind of a bouncy texture. The spatula has a soft plastic tip. You can use it like a spoon to scoop out the pudding tint. The spreading of the tint is better done with the backside of the spoon, or with a separate lip brush or your fingers. The color of the pudding tint is super vibrant and highly pigmented, but also can be blended in as soft gradient. As for the staying power of this lip tint the stain is visible quite a long time. It may be not as vibrant as when you apply it, but it doesn’t look bad either. If you have dry lips you should exfoliate your lips definitely in advance, otherwise the vibrant pink color will cling to every dry lip flake or wrinkle. The lip tint jar contains 5.5 g and retails for 10.40 US$.

The Etude House Snowy Dessert Play 101 Pencils, which I received in shade No.71 and No. 73 are both pencils with a shimmering finish. They come in a plastic box and have a stripe design. No. 71 is a light pink color, whereas No. 73 is a light pearly color.

Etude House Pink Bird

Both shades are super pretty for the under-eye area or the inner corners of your eyes for highlighting. You can twist up the pencils and there is also a tiny sharpener included for sharpening the tip of the pencils. The texture of the product is a creamy type pencil, so it is also useable as eyeshadow for example. I love the shades, because they are really subtle and yet have such a pretty sparkle. Each pencil contains 0.5g and retails for 7.80 US$.

Last but not least the Etude House Pink Bird Box November contained the Honey Cera 4-in-1 Kit. The new Etude House Honey Cera line contains honey as key ingredient for nourishing and moisturizing. Furthermore, it contains Royal Jelly and Ceramide. Royal Jelly has nourishing properties like the honey and Ceramide strengthens the skin barrier. Also, you will find extracts of the Helichrysum italicum or also called Italian Immortelle or Curry Plant in the Etude House Honey Cera Line. The purpose of this extract is soothing and moisturizing. Aim of this line is to make the skin plump and nourished and give it the “honey-look”. These ingredients are perfect for winter-time and for dry and rough skin types!

Etude House Pink Bird

I cannot say anything about the long-term effects of this set since it is too few to make any conclusions, but from my first impression I really like this kit. The scent is a nice sweet and flowery scent, but nothing like honey as I imagined before. Unlike most other toners the Honey Cera Toner has a milky color, but the consistency is watery nevertheless. It absorbs quite fast without stickiness. The emulsion is a lightweight lotion, whereas the cream has a thick and nourishing consistency. The cream also leaves the skin a bit tacky afterwards, but definitively  the nourishing and firming aspect is noticeable. The eye serum looks like a balm but is very light and doesn’t feel heavy. It feels nice under and above the eye. Toner and Emulsion contain 15ml each, the eye serum contains 4 ml and the cream contains 10 mg of product.
